Aluminum Alloy Types: 6061 vs 5083 vs 6063 Explained

The alloy designation is the single most important specification for aluminum pipe. It determines strength, corrosion resistance, weldability, machinability, and cost. Three alloys dominate industrial tubing: 6061-T6, 5083-H112, and 6063-T5. Each serves distinct application profiles.

6061-T6 is the workhorse of structural aluminum. The "T6" temper indicates solution heat-treated and artificially aged condition, delivering optimal mechanical properties. With tensile strength of 260MPa and yield strength of 240MPa, 6061-T6 offers excellent strength-to-weight ratio for load-bearing applications [1]. Its balanced property profile makes it suitable for automotive frames, aerospace components, electronics enclosures, and general industrial fixtures.

5083-H112 is the marine-grade champion. With magnesium content of 4.0-4.9%, this alloy delivers exceptional corrosion resistance in seawater, freshwater, and chemical environments [1]. However, it's non-heat-treatable, and strength degrades above 65°C. Yield strength is lower at 125MPa, but tensile strength reaches 270MPa. The key advantage: 5083 maintains strength after welding, making it ideal for shipbuilding, fuel tankers, and offshore applications.

6063-T5 serves architectural and decorative purposes. It offers superior anodizing characteristics and surface finish quality, though with lower mechanical strength than 6061. Common applications include handrails, furniture frames, and building facades where appearance matters as much as function.

Aluminum Alloy Comparison: Properties and Applications

Property6061-T65083-H1126063-T5
Tensile Strength260 MPa270 MPa150-180 MPa
Yield Strength240 MPa125 MPa110-140 MPa
Corrosion ResistanceGoodExcellent (marine grade)Good
WeldabilityGoodExcellentGood
MachinabilityGoodFairExcellent
Heat TreatableYesNoYes
Max Working Temp150°C+65°C (avoid stress corrosion)150°C+
Primary ApplicationsStructural, automotive, aerospaceMarine, chemical, fuel tanksArchitectural, decorative
Data compiled from FONNOV Aluminium and MarineAlu technical specifications [1][5]. Actual properties vary by manufacturer and specific temper condition.

Cost Considerations: 6061 typically commands a 10-20% premium over 6063 due to higher strength and broader applicability. 5083 can be 15-30% more expensive than 6061, reflecting its specialized marine-grade composition and production complexity. For budget-conscious projects without corrosion or high-strength requirements, 6063 offers adequate performance at lower cost.

For Southeast Asian buyers: Regional suppliers in Thailand, Indonesia, and Vietnam increasingly offer 6061 and 6063 tubing with competitive pricing. However, marine applications should verify 5083 certification—some suppliers substitute lower-grade alloys that fail in saltwater environments within months.

Pipe Dimensions and Tolerance Standards: What Buyers Must Verify

Dimensional specifications define the physical parameters of aluminum tubing. Three measurement systems coexist in global trade: imperial (inch-based), metric (millimeter-based), and NPS (Nominal Pipe Size). Confusion between these systems causes frequent ordering errors.

Round Tubing is specified by Outside Diameter (OD) and wall thickness. Standard OD ranges from 3/16" (4.76mm) to 10" (254mm) for stock items [2]. Wall thickness spans 0.035" (0.89mm) to 0.500" (12.7mm). Common industrial sizes include 1/2", 3/4", 1", 1-1/2", and 2" OD. Note: 2" OD equals 50.8mm, NOT 50mm—a distinction that matters for precision fittings.

Rectangular Tubing is specified by two leg lengths and wall thickness (e.g., 1" x 2" x 0.125"). Common applications include structural frames, machinery guards, and support brackets.

Square Tubing uses equal leg lengths (e.g., 1" x 1" x 0.125"). Preferred for furniture, railings, and electrical enclosures where symmetrical appearance matters.

Tolerance Standards vary by application grade:

  • Structural tubing (ASTM B221): OD tolerance ±0.010" to ±0.030" depending on size; wall thickness ±10%
  • Drawn tubing (ASTM B210): Tighter tolerances, OD ±0.005" to ±0.015"; wall thickness ±5%
  • Seamless pipe (ASTM B241): Highest precision for pressure applications; OD ±0.004" to ±0.010"

Critical Verification Steps for B2B Buyers:

  1. Request certified dimensional reports before bulk ordering. Reputable suppliers provide mill test certificates (MTC) with actual measurements from production batches.

  2. Specify tolerance class in your purchase order. Don't accept generic "standard tolerance"—define acceptable deviation ranges based on your application.

  3. Order samples first for critical applications. Measure OD, wall thickness, and straightness with calibrated tools before committing to large quantities.

  4. Clarify measurement system explicitly. State "50.8mm (2 inch)" or "50mm (1.969 inch)" to avoid ambiguity.

  5. Verify straightness tolerance for long lengths. Structural applications typically require ≤0.020" per foot; precision applications may need ≤0.010" per foot.

Application Scenarios: Matching Pipe Specifications to Use Cases

Selecting the right aluminum pipe requires matching specifications to application demands. We've analyzed common industrial use cases to provide clear guidance.

Construction & Scaffolding:

  • Alloy: 6061-T6 or 6063-T5
  • Size: 1" to 2" OD, wall thickness 0.120"-0.180"
  • Why: Adequate strength for load-bearing, cost-effective, good weldability
  • Special requirements: Anodized or powder-coated finish for weather resistance

Marine & Offshore:

  • Alloy: 5083-H112 (mandatory for saltwater exposure)
  • Size: 1-1/2" to 4" OD, wall thickness 0.180"-0.350"
  • Why: Exceptional corrosion resistance in seawater, maintains strength after welding
  • Special requirements: Verify marine-grade certification, avoid 6061 in direct saltwater contact

Automotive & Transportation:

  • Alloy: 6061-T6
  • Size: 3/4" to 2" OD, wall thickness 0.065"-0.120"
  • Why: High strength-to-weight ratio, good fatigue resistance
  • Special requirements: Tight tolerances for assembly, often require precision cutting

Aerospace & Aviation:

  • Alloy: 6061-T6 (general), 2024-T3 (high-stress components)
  • Size: 1/2" to 3" OD, wall thickness 0.049"-0.120"
  • Why: Meets aviation standards, consistent mechanical properties
  • Special requirements: Full traceability, mill test certificates mandatory, tighter tolerances (±0.005")

HVAC & Refrigeration:

  • Alloy: 3003-H14 or 6063-T5
  • Size: 1/4" to 2" OD, wall thickness 0.035"-0.065"
  • Why: Good formability for bending, adequate corrosion resistance
  • Special requirements: Clean, oil-free interior for refrigerant applications

Solar Mounting Systems:

  • Alloy: 6063-T5 or 6061-T6
  • Size: 1" to 2" OD, wall thickness 0.065"-0.120"
  • Why: Weather resistance, structural stability, cost-effective for large installations
  • Special requirements: Anodized finish for UV resistance, pre-drilled holes for fast installation

Maintenance Requirements: Extending Aluminum Pipe Lifespan

Proper maintenance transforms aluminum pipe from a commodity purchase into a long-term asset. With correct care, aluminum tubing can serve 30-50 years in favorable conditions, or 15-20 years in aggressive environments [3].

Corrosion Prevention Fundamentals:

Aluminum naturally forms a protective oxide layer, but this defense has limits. Understanding corrosion mechanisms helps you select appropriate prevention strategies:

  • Galvanic Corrosion: Occurs when aluminum contacts dissimilar metals (especially copper or stainless steel) in presence of electrolyte. Prevention: Use dielectric unions or insulating gaskets at connection points [3].

  • Pitting Corrosion: Localized attack in chloride-rich environments (coastal areas, de-icing salts). Prevention: Anodized or powder-coated finishes create barrier protection [3].

  • Stress Corrosion Cracking: Affects 5083 alloy above 65°C under sustained load. Prevention: Avoid 5083 in high-temperature applications; use 6061 instead [5].

Cleaning Protocols:

  1. Routine Cleaning (Monthly): Mild soap solution with soft cloth or sponge. Rinse thoroughly with clean water. Avoid alkaline cleaners—they attack aluminum's oxide layer [3].

  2. Stubborn Contaminants: Use mild acidic cleaners (diluted vinegar or citric acid). Apply, wait 5 minutes, scrub gently, rinse immediately. Never use steel wool or abrasive pads—they embed iron particles that cause rust staining [3].

  3. Industrial Environments: For oil, grease, or chemical residues, use aluminum-safe degreasers. Test on small area first. Rinse thoroughly to prevent cleaner residue from attracting dirt [3].

  4. Post-Cleaning Protection: Apply automotive wax or specialized aluminum protectant every 6-12 months. This adds sacrificial layer that slows oxidation and makes future cleaning easier [3].

Aluminum Pipe Maintenance Schedule by Environment

Environment TypeInspection FrequencyCleaning FrequencySpecial Requirements
Indoor (climate-controlled)Annual visual inspectionEvery 6 monthsStandard cleaning, check for mechanical damage
Indoor (industrial)Quarterly inspectionMonthlyCheck for chemical exposure, verify coating integrity
Outdoor (mild climate)Semi-annual inspectionEvery 3 monthsInspect for UV degradation, reapply protective coating annually
Outdoor (coastal/marine)Quarterly inspectionMonthlyCheck for pitting corrosion, verify anodizing/powder coating, rinse after salt exposure
Chemical processingMonthly inspectionWeeklyVerify chemical compatibility, inspect for stress corrosion, maintain detailed logs
Maintenance schedule based on Voyage Metal longevity guidelines [3]. Adjust frequency based on actual operating conditions and visual inspection findings.

Inspection Best Practices:

Regular inspections catch problems before they become failures:

  • Visual Inspection: Look for discoloration, white powder (aluminum oxide), pitting, or coating damage. Early detection allows spot treatment before corrosion spreads [3].

  • Thickness Measurement: Use ultrasonic thickness gauge annually for critical applications. Compare readings to original specifications—10% wall loss indicates replacement needed [3].

  • Joint Inspection: Check mechanical joints for loosening, welded joints for cracks. Thermal cycling causes expansion/contraction that can fatigue connections [3].

  • Documentation: Maintain inspection logs with dates, findings, and corrective actions. This creates maintenance history valuable for warranty claims and asset management [3].

Aluminum Pipe Configuration Comparison Matrix

ConfigurationCost LevelBest ForLimitationsRisk Factors
6061-T6 Standard WallMediumGeneral structural, automotive, machineryNot suitable for marine/saltwaterGalvanic corrosion if connected to copper/stainless
6061-T6 Heavy WallHighHigh-load structural, pressure applicationsHigher weight, higher costOver-specification for light-duty uses increases cost unnecessarily
5083-H112 Marine GradeHighMarine, offshore, chemical processingLower yield strength, max 65°C operating tempStress corrosion cracking above 65°C, higher material cost
6063-T5 ArchitecturalLow-MediumDecorative, handrails, furnitureLower mechanical strengthNot suitable for load-bearing structural applications
3003-H14 FormableLowHVAC, bending applications, light-dutyLowest strength of common alloysNot suitable for structural or high-stress applications
Anodized Finish+15-25% costOutdoor, architectural, high-visibilityColor matching challenges for replacementsAnodizing layer can chip under impact
Powder Coated Finish+20-30% costHarsh environments, color-specific needsRequires surface prep, thicker coatingCoating damage exposes bare aluminum to corrosion
Mill Finish (uncoated)Base costIndoor, painted-after-purchase, budget projectsMinimal corrosion protectionRequires immediate protection in outdoor/marine environments
Cost levels are relative comparisons within aluminum tubing category. Actual pricing varies by supplier, order quantity, and region. Data compiled from industry sources [1][2][5][7].

Red Flags to Avoid:

Based on buyer experiences across Reddit and Amazon, watch for these warning signs:

  1. Suppliers refusing factory visits for large orders—legitimate manufacturers welcome audits [9]
  2. Vague alloy specifications like "aviation aluminum" or "marine grade" without specific alloy number (6061, 5083, etc.)
  3. Prices significantly below market—aluminum is a commodity with transparent pricing; 30%+ discounts often indicate inferior material or scams
  4. No mill test certificates available for structural or pressure applications
  5. Dimensional tolerances not specified in product listings or quotations
  6. Mixed metric/imperial specifications without clear conversion (2" ≠ 50mm)

Common Pitfalls for Southeast Asian Buyers:

  1. Underestimating shipping costs: Aluminum is heavy—freight can add 15-25% to landed cost. Get DDP (Delivered Duty Paid) quotes, not just FOB prices.

  2. Ignoring import documentation: Ensure suppliers provide commercial invoice, packing list, certificate of origin, and mill test certificates. Missing documents cause customs delays costing more than air freight premiums.

  3. Currency fluctuation risk: USD-denominated contracts expose buyers to exchange rate volatility. Consider hedging strategies or negotiate local currency pricing where possible.

  4. Quality verification gaps: Don't rely solely on supplier-provided photos. Request video calls showing actual production, or hire third-party inspectors for large orders.

  5. After-sales support assumptions: Clarify warranty terms, return policies, and technical support availability before ordering. Time zone differences complicate dispute resolution.
